President Joe Biden on Tuesday signed legislation protecting same-sex and interracial marriage.

Thousands of people gathered on the White House South Lawn to commemorate the Respect for Marriage Act becoming law.

“Today is a good day,” Biden said as he took the podium after Vice President Kamala Harris. “A day America takes a vital step toward equality, for liberty and justice — not just for some, but for everyone. Toward creating a nation where decency, dignity and love are recognized, honored and protected.”MORE: What the Respect for Marriage Act does and doesn’t do

“Look, we’re here today to celebrate their courage and everyone who made the day possible,” the president continued. “Courage that led to progress we’ve seen over the decades, progress that gives us hope that every generation will continue on our journey toward a more perfect union.”
